We were lucky enough to be invited down to Cammerlaws Farm by lovely Edinburgh Cake Lady Pamela who was having her first ‘pop-up’ afternoon tea event with her mum on their farm in the Borders.
Two car loads of ladies headed down – our first cake road trip!
We were warmly welcomed by Pamela and her mum, Anne.
A welcome drink of prosecco was offered and we had canapés in the lounge whilst the afternoon tea was set up in the dining room.
The dining room was set up beautifully and everyone squealed with delight at the towers of sandwiches and cakes.
We devoured everything in sight and drank lashings of Anteaques tea.
There were still three full-sized cakes on the sideboard for us, but we all took a walk around the working farm to see the animals.
Back to the house for more tea and cake.
Considering it was their first event, we were suitably impressed. The hosts were perfect and the food divine.
